Northeast Georgia, Habersham Medical Centers to Form Partnership

Gainesville, Ga.-based Northeast Georgia Medical Center has signed a letter of intent with the Habersham County Hospital Authority to work toward a partnership with Habersham Medical Center in Demorest, Ga.

Both groups specified in the letter they would work toward a possible lease arrangement, although they haven't officially decided on the partnership model, according to a news release. The two organizations will now move into a phase of due diligence, which officials expect will last until late fall. After that, the medical centers expect to sign a definitive agreement and submit it to the state's attorney general for review.

The attorney general's review will likely take four to six months, and hospital officials don't expect any operational changes to take place until spring 2014, according to the release.
